Convict at Large in Wellington.

(UY. TKLIiUK.VfII —riIKSS ASSOCIATION. )

Wellington, Monday,

Tiik prisonor Crabtreo is Hill at large. At tho ollicial inquiry hold today, it was shown that tho uiothnd by which ho had obtained his liberty was very ingenious. Ho had by some mea'iH obtained a gougo, and first tried to removo tho staplo of the door. Finding thid impossible, he gouged out tho hingou and was then onablea to force tho door open from tho back, and squeeze himself out. How ho got over the gaol wall without being obsorvod is not known, but as the walla are not high thoro would bo no great dilh'culty in doing so if the convict got out of his cell while darkness prevailed. Tho inquiry shows nogligenco on tho part of Iho warder whoso duty it was to inspect tho colls through tho night. It i* believed that Crabtroo is boing sholtered in town. LATER, Crabtreo i°not yet re-caplurcd. Severn! roports nro curront of prisoner being seen in various parts of the town, but they aro without foundation. Tho wnrdor on duty at tho tiino of eecapohos been suspended.
